> We generate the metadata at runtime using custom database queries and in
> odata4j we can cache the metadata document to avoid having to rebuild it
> every time a request is received. How can metadata be cached between requests
> in olingo? Following the simple read example on the olingo website, we use an
> ODataServiceFactory to create a service using method
> createODataSingleProcessorService(), but these methods are invoked during
> each request.
